Meaning & History

Haliya is the name of a Bicolano moon deity. There is an ancient ritual named after her performed in Bicol during the full moon, which was believed to frighten away Bakunawa, a serpent-like dragon in Philippine mythology. In modern interpretations, she wears a gold mask to hide her beauty.
